col: 18 Error: Call to a possibly undefined method setEnemyPool through a reference with static type object.Pool:CreateAllPool.
если убрать set из функции, то работает
Код AS3:
private var enemyPool:PoolEnemy;
private var createAllPool:CreateAllPool;
private function createPoolEnemy():void
{
var enemys:Array = new Array();
var enemyOne:EnemyOne = new EnemyOne();
enemys.push(enemyOne);
createAllPool = new CreateAllPool();
createAllPool.setEnemyPool(enemys); //тут отправляем ссылку
}
Код AS3:
package object.Pool
{
public class CreateAllPool
{
public function CreateAllPool()
{
}
//**********************************************************
private var enemys:Array;
public function set setEnemyPool(_enemys:Array):void //здесь получаем
{
enemys = _enemys;
}
}
}